It is of major importance to dedicate time to the bridal makeup, because on that day you desire to feel special and the photographs taken will function as a vivid memory for the rest of their life. We know what kind of makeup is nee-ded for every type of bride, it is unique for every single one of them, and professional makeup artists focus mainly on making good details noticeable while correcting facial fea-tures that the bride is not comfortable with, always putting the bride’s desires as a priority.

Today we are going to learn further about the bridal makeup process as a result of an interview performed on Veronica Villareal, a Professional Image Stylist that has a wide career with around 12 years of experience backing her up inside the Professional Stylist business world.

Since when and how did you start working with this D’Salon project?D’Salon first starts approximately 3 years ago after 12 years of hard work inside the great Professional Styling world.

What is your major inspiration while working on embellishing an upcoming bride?My inspiration is founded on creating a unique work of art on each of the brides, and focusing on making each of their beautiful facial features stand out, so she can look bright and perfect.

How do you accomplish to satisfy the brides?The first thing is to have direct communication with them, to listen to each and every single one of their ideas, know their personality and then work on a strategy to satisfy their expectative. When I am working on bridal makeup, I utilize oil free cosmetics that ensure stability and care of their skin. An oil free cosmetic guarantees the perfect ba-lance of natural skin oil, putting an end to the oily skin look and perspiration conflicts that can generally occur.

Which is the main restlessness issue that the brides pre-sent during the makeup process?

One of the main anxieties that the brides develop is the time that the makeup will hold and how much will it last. As a professional, I guarantee all the brides that nothing is going to happen (makeup wise) since I only use professional cos-metic products of great quality. That along with a good fea-ture correcting technique and airbrush being applied step by step, I can ensure the makeup will hold and last.

Why is it important that the bride looks stunningly per-fect? Simply because that day is the most important event of her life and she has to look beautiful and perfect so she can portray and illustrate her enormous happiness.

What is the bridal makeup tendency?When working on bridal makeup, we will focus and base our work on the bride’s personality and her own style. The most solicited makeup services are standing out eyes in di-fferent shades of colors such as maroon, black or gray. We also are often requested neutral colors with great bright-ness in shades of gold, eyelashes of extensive volume and sensual yet discreet lips.

Is there any advantage when using airbrush makeup?The airbrush tool is amazing! It leaves a layer of makeup perfectly layered, skin is completely covered and corrected

What should the bride always need to be aware of? She has to get ready a day before the wedding event. Try on the makeup that she is going to be wearing for that special occasion; that usually calms the bride down so when the wedding day is finally here, she does not have to be concerned about the makeup anymore

Could you share any tips for those brides that want to look radiant on that special occasion?Wedding planning can be one of the most stressful preparations. I would personally recommend those brides to go through a series of skin, body and hair care treatments to look even more alluring during that exceptional day. I would also counsel them to not hesitate on wea-ring airbrush makeup and its benefits, they are going to love the results.

ME Cancun is a contemporary adult-oriented resort. It’s a chic South Beach experience in the Mexican Caribbean perfectly designed for discerning travelers. ME Cancun is not your typical all-inclusive, it’s what we call “A Complete Experience Beyond Mere Accommodations.” Recognized as the social epicenter of Cancun, the ME by Melia hotel embraces the philosophy of Yin & Yang and expresses it with its unique bars, spa, fitness center, restaurants and beach club. The concept of the resort is exclusively designed for those in search of a balanced experience of relaxation and excitement.

The resort’s offers 434 contemporary guestrooms and 80 ME+ suites all designed with unique artwork and eclectic style. What is ME+? It is an adult élite premium collection of suites complemented by VIP amenities, exclusive privileges and personalized service overseen by the ME+ host. Then there is the modern Suite ME, a spectacular two-story residence with terraces overlooking the sea, a cylindrical Aquarium, and a Jacuzzi for 10 persons.

The Yin focuses on wellness, is all about connecting with the inner you! The chill-out zone is a quiet beachside haven ideal for relaxation, fitness and healthy living encouraging guests to attain clarity, balance and strength. The Fitness Center is open 24/7 and features Life-Fitness machines and spinning X-Bikes as well as group yoga, Pilates and cardio classes. Need more focus, a full selection of private, one-on-one classes are also available and include yoga, Tai Chi, Tae Bo, aerobics, spinning and Pilates. The YHI SPA at ME Cancun is dedicated to the purification of the body, the balance of the mind and the cultivation of the soul. The spa features a Vichy humid spa, hydrotherapy center, couples massage suite, hydro massage suites and facial suites. In addition, treatments can be accompanied with delicious teas or juices, which undoubtedly will complete the experience.

Famous among jet-set locals in Cancun, The Beach Club features an infinity pool and international music by some of the best DJ´s and is host to spectacular feasts.The Yin & Yang is the exceptional globally inspired cuisine at ME Cancun. Featuring five outstanding options, it requires several days and nights to enjoy all of the culinary offerings at ME Cancun. Salt Restaurant, an intimate enclave, serves an International breakfast buffet by day and Mediterranean cuisine by night. Silk Restaurant is chic contemporary Asian bistro serving teppanyaki and sushi. The Water Grill is a South American grill offering a variety of dishes for lunch and dinner with a spectacular oceanfront view. The Beachhouse features seafood and Caribbean flavors for lunch and turns into a Mexican fusion restaurant for dinner. For light snacks guests can check out E-Space, the resort’s cyber café.
